    When driving around at highway speeds, >60, I start to get this humming sound. The sound is very rhythmic, about one second on and one second off. Along with a very minor vibration in pedal and steering wheel. This happens whether I’m on the gas or not. Feels like I’m driving on something like this continuously when over 60mph:IMG_8617.jpg
    I tried to take a video but it may be hard to hear. I’ll upload it anyway to see if it’s helpful to anyone.

    https://share.icloud.com/photos/05ccv3xl27ivA6-w5nwcxxgkQ

    Based on what I’ve researched. Could it be a wheel bearing?

    Could be. Bad wheel bearings normally making a growling sound. Jack the truck up and check the bearings, give them a good shake down at 12 and 6 position and then 3 and 9.
